22 * SECTION:element-rtpklvpay
23 * @see_also: rtpklvdepay
25 * Payloads KLV metadata into RTP packets according to RFC 6597.
26 * For detailed information see: http://tools.ietf.org/html/rfc6597
29 * <title>Example pipeline</title>
31 * gst-launch-1.0 filesrc location=video-with-klv.ts ! tsdemux ! rtpklvpay ! udpsink
32 * ]| This example pipeline will payload an RTP KLV stream extracted from an
33 * MPEG-TS stream and send it via UDP to an RTP receiver.
